A measure of the average kinetic energy of the individual particles in an object is called temperature.
Average KE is proportional to the temperature of the particles measured in Kelvin.Energy is measured in Joules and temperature is measured in Kelvin or Celsius. Do not think that they are the same thing.KE = 1/2mv2 for macroscopic objects but the equation for working out the KE of particles is quite complicated.
